Pascal Morel is a scholar working on Hematology, Management of Technology and Innovation and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Pascal Morel has authored 148 papers receiving a total of 2.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Hematology, 34 papers in Management of Technology and Innovation and 30 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Pascal Morel's work include Blood donation and transfusion practices (34 papers), Blood transfusion and management (23 papers) and Blood groups and transfusion (18 papers). Pascal Morel is often cited by papers focused on Blood donation and transfusion practices (34 papers), Blood transfusion and management (23 papers) and Blood groups and transfusion (18 papers). Pascal Morel coll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and United States. Pascal Morel's co-authors include Pierre Fenaux, Pierre Gallian, JL Laï, Pierre Tiberghien, J L Laï, F Bauters, Xavier de Lamballerie, Syria Laperche, Patrick Hervé and Danielle Rebibo and has published in prestigious journals such as Blood, PLoS ONE and Hepatology.
